Kass-Morgan Group Farm Pond

Cottonwood River-TR· Lyon, Minnesota· Built 1975· Earth· 26 ft tall
Significant Hazard Flood Risk Reduction Private

Key Takeaway

Kass-Morgan Group Farm Pond is classified as significant hazard in Minnesota. It was completed in 1975 and is 51 years old. Its primary use is flood risk reduction. Significant hazard means failure could cause economic or environmental damage. Learn more.

Safety Information

Significant Hazard

No probable loss of human life, but can cause economic loss, environmental damage, or disruption of lifeline facilities.

Hazard potential describes downstream consequences of failure, not the dam's current condition. What does this mean?
